I have seen the effects on someone who was a victim of Alzheimer's, it's not a pretty site, let me tell you. They are there, yet, they're not. Sometimes they're lucid and sound somewhat normal. They have a tendency to repeat stories from the past over and over again. Their "short term memory" is drastically damaged. Yet, they can remember the past (40-50 years back) like it was just yesterday. This insidious disease robs a person of their humanity, piece by piece.

I took care of a victim of an advanced form of Alzheimer's in 2008. She was in her late 80s and not related to me. She was the Mother of a childhood friend of mine. She'd sit on the couch and tell a tale of something that happened 50 years ago or so. Like clockwork, she'd tell the exact same story ten minutes later. I'd pretend I was hearing it for the first time and act accordingly. This would go on all day long.

My friend told me he didn't have the patience for his Mother's disease. My Son visited me and witnessed this ladies situation and told me, "I couldn't take that more than about twenty minutes." After about 8 months of taking care of this Lady, I moved to another state and my friend had to place his Mother in a convalescent home, she died there. It takes a lot of patience to be in the presence of such an illness.
